このコースについて
Calculus serves as a powerful tool for describing the natural world, from the movement of planets to the growth of populations. This course focuses on the core principles of integration, providing the mathematical building blocks necessary for success in technical and scientific fields.
You will transition from basic concepts to applying calculus to solve intricate problems, focusing on conceptual clarity and practical utility. By reading through detailed explanations and practicing with written exercises, you will gain the confidence to use calculus as a problem-solving instrument.
What you'll learn:
- Understand the fundamental theorem of calculus and the conceptual basis of integration.
- Apply integration techniques to calculate areas, volumes, and work in physical systems.
- Master the use of Taylor series and power series for function approximation.
- Practice solving real-world problems in the physical and social sciences using integral models.
- Learn numerical integration methods used in modern computational analysis.
The course begins with foundational definitions and the geometry of the integral before moving into advanced techniques and series expansions. It is designed for beginners in engineering, physics, or economics who have a basic grasp of algebra and differentiation. Start your journey toward mathematical proficiency today.
